Hi experts

After I have done all configurations for GOA distribution with GOAs succesfully tranfered to R/3 as Scheduling agreemnt my GOA still in status 'IN DISTRIBUTION' besides I heve creted schedule lines for the contracts in R/3 and nothing updated in SRM GOA.

Hi Nilson,

usually this is related to a missing config. Have a look into the outbound queue in SRM. Are there any information? Have a look into WE02 in the Backend as well. Is there any Idoc related to the GOA with an error?

Hi Nilson,

Please, check if there still is an entry in the table BBP_DOCUMENT_TAB for the GOA. If CLEAN_REQREQ_UP had run then there should not be an entry here.

Also, changes to the contract in R/3 will not reflect in the GOA in SRM.

Hi Nilson,

If the document number is there in bbp_document_tab then clean_reqreq_up has not updated the status for this GOA. You can possibly try to run the report again by directly giving the document number (you will find the key in the table).

The IDOC BLAORD needs to be checked in backend not BLAREL.
